Chemical Property Profile of 5H-purine
Property Insights of 5H-purine
The XLogP value of -0.8 indicates that 5H-purine is hydrophilic (water-soluble), making it suitable for aqueous formulations and biological assay applications. With a topological polar surface area (TPSA) of 49.4 Ų, 5H-purine ex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 5H-purine has 0 hydrogen bond donor(s) and 1 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
